Puri Beach Illegal Water-Sports Facility Demolished

Illegal Water Sports Facility Demolished at Puri Beach After Safety Breach

Puri, May 28 : In a decisive move to ensure tourist safety, the Puri district administration on Tuesday demolished an unauthorized water sports facility operating in the Baliapanda area of Puri beach. The crackdown comes in the wake of a recent mishap involving a speedboat operated by the facility, which raised serious concerns about safety standards.

The facility, operating under the name Sky Dive Adventure and Water Sports, had been offering high-risk activities such as speedboat rides and skydiving experiences without the necessary authorisations or safety protocols.

Trouble surfaced last Saturday when a speedboat from the facility capsized, throwing all onboard passengers into the sea. Among the passengers were Snehasis Ganguly, brother of former Indian cricketer Sourav Ganguly, and his wife Arpita. Fortunately, quick action by local lifeguards ensured the safe rescue of all individuals involved. The Gangulys have since returned to Kolkata safely.

Following the incident, the district administration launched an inquiry into the operations of the facility. The investigation revealed that the establishment was functioning without proper licenses and had grossly inadequate safety measures in place for tourists.

Acting swiftly on the findings, officials moved to dismantle the illegal structure using a bulldozer. The demolition is part of a broader initiative by the local administration to regulate beachside tourism activities and enhance safety for visitors.

Authorities have reiterated their commitment to maintaining strict oversight of tourist facilities and have warned that any establishment found flouting safety norms will face immediate and severe action.

District officials have urged tourists to only engage in water sports through certified operators and to always prioritize safety over thrill.
